From: "jan.smets at nokia dot com" <gcc-bugzilla@gcc.gnu.org> To: gcc-bugs@gcc.gnu.org Subject: [Bug c/100671] override-init suppressed in 'two shot' compilation when initializer macro/value is defined in system header file Date: Wed, 19 May 2021 09:14:45 +0000 [thread overview] Message-ID: <bug-100671-4-ONYrIJ12C5@http.g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/> (raw) In-Reply-To: <bug-100671-4@http.g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/> https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=100671 --- Comment #1 from Jan Smets <jan.smets at nokia dot com> --- Another one we've had problems with is quite similar. The example below is a void function trying to return a value. #if 1 /* NULL defined in a system header file => warning in "one shot" compilation. => no warning in "two shot" compilation. */ #include <stddef.h> #else /* always warns */ #define NULL (0L) #endif void test(void) { return NULL; }
